Ingredient

Here are the ingredients you will need to make this delicious banana bread:
  • 3 ripe bananas
  • 1/3 cup melted butter
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• Pinch of salt
  • 3/4 cup sugar
  • 1 large egg, beaten
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our

Bananas

Make sure your bananas are ripe. Ripe bananas are soft and have brown spots on the skin. They are easier to mash and will give your banana bread a sweeter flavour. If your bananas are not ripe enough, you can put them in a brown paper bag with an apple or tomato for a day or two to speed up the ripening process.

Baking Soda

Baking soda is a leavening agent that helps your banana bread rise. It also helps to neutralize the acidity in the bananas.

Sugar

You can use white or brown sugar for this recipe. Brown sugar will give your banana bread a deeper flavour and a denser texture.

Egg

The egg in this recipe acts as a binding agent and helps to give your banana bread structure.

Instructions

Now that you have all your ingredients, it's time to start baking!
  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9x5 inch loaf pan.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, mash your ripe bananas with a fork.
  3. Add melted butter and mix well.
  4. Add baking soda, salt, and sugar. Mix well.
  5. Add beaten egg and vanilla extract. Mix well.
  6. Add all-purpose flour and mix until just combined. Do not overmix.
  7. Pour batter into the prepared loaf pan.
  8. Bake for 50-60 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the centre of the loaf comes out clean.
  9. Let the banana bread cool in the pan for 10 minutes before removing it and placing it on a wire rack to cool completely.
  10. Slice and serve!

Nutrition

Here is the approximate nutrition information for one slice (1/10th of the loaf) of banana bread:
  • Calories: 210
  • Fat: 7g
  • Saturated Fat: 4g
  • Cholesterol: 35mg
  • Sodium: 220mg
  • Carbohydrates: 35g
  • Fibre: 1g
  • Sugar: 19g
  • Protein: 3g

Storage

Banana bread can be stored at room temperature for up to 3 days, or in the fridge for up to a week. You can also freeze banana bread for up to 3 months. Make sure to w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or foil before freezing.

Variations

If you want to mix things up, here are some variations you can try:
  • Add chocolate chips to the batter for a chocolatey twist.
  • Add chopped nuts like walnuts or pecans for a crunch.
  • Add cinnamon or nutmeg for a warm spice flavour.
  • Swap out the all-purpose flour for whole wheat flour for a healthier twist.
  • Use maple syrup instead of sugar for a different flavour profile.
